From e3d8eddb3af572a66a59f6994ce8e98b72e487ff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Christoph Keller Date: Wed, 7 Apr 2021 14:39:13 +0200 Subject: Only embed launch screen when building an app MIME-Version: 1.0 Content-Type: text/plain; charset=UTF-8 Content-Transfer-Encoding: 8bit Xcode's new build system checks duplicated entries when building. Qmake wants to embed the launch screen for all types of configurations (static libraries etc.) which makes Xcode bail out with "Multiple commands produce LaunchScreen.storyboard".
